Directions

1

Prepare Sushi Rice

Rinse the sushi rice under cold water until the water runs clear. In a pot, combine the rinsed rice and water. Bring to a boil, then reduce to low heat, cover, and cook for 20 minutes. Remove from heat and let it sit covered for another 10 minutes.

2

Season the Rice

In a small bowl, mix the rice vinegar and sugar until dissolved. Once the rice has rested, transfer it to a large bowl and gently fold in the vinegar mixture. Allow it to cool to room temperature.

3

Prepare Fillings

Slice the avocado, scallions, and imitation crab meat into thin strips. Set aside.

4

Assemble the Roll

Place a bamboo sushi mat on a flat surface. Lay a sheet of nori on the mat, shiny side down. With wet hands, spread a thin layer of sushi rice over the nori, leaving a 1-inch border at the top. Lay smoked salmon, cream cheese, avocado, crab meat, and scallions in a line across the center of the rice.

5

Roll the Sushi

Using the sushi mat, carefully roll the nori away from you, pressing firmly to form a tight roll. Once rolled, use a sharp knife to slice the roll into 8 pieces. Repeat with remaining ingredients.

6

Finish the Roll

Top each sushi piece with a small amount of masago and a drizzle of Nakato hot sauce. Serve with soy sauce on the side.
